AFS Corporate Member The C.A. Lawton Co. (Lawton) (DePere, Wisconsin), owned by private equity firm Oakland Standard Co., has acquired Midwest Manufacturing & Logistics (Midwest) (Minster, Ohio) from Nidec Minster Corp. (Nidec). The Ohio iron foundry will operate as a second location of Lawton.

Pace Industries, LLC (Pace) (Fayetteville, Arkansas) emerged from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ection in early June, successfully completing its financial restructuring plan to deleverage its balance sheet and create a sustainable capital structure. The company is an aluminum, magnesium and zinc diecaster.

Fonderie Mora Gavardo (Gavardo, Italy) has appointed AFS Corporate Member General Kinematics (GK) (Crystal Lake, Illinois) to be the system integrator and equipment provider for their new foundry system. The decision was based on previous experience with GK’s design and installation of a shakeout system, GK’s experience implementing numerous turn-key foundry installations worldwide, and their ability to deliver the full system.

Grede (Southfield, Michigan), the leading developer, manufacturer, assembler and supplier of ductile, gray and specialty iron castings and machined components for automotive, commercial vehicle and industrial markets, has purchased certain assets of Renaissance Manufacturing Group (RMG) Waukesha, LLC.

AFS Corporate Member Charlotte Pipe and Foundry Company announced it is moving its headquarters to Oakboro, North Carolina, and building a new foundry there on the 428-acre property.

AFS Corporate Member Wellman Dynamics (Creston, Iowa) has purchased the former Ferrara Candy Company property at 500 Industrial Parkway in Creston. The property includes 315,000 sq. ft. of manufacturing, office, and warehouse space, along with approximately 20 acres of land. The facility will be repurposed for an expansion of Wellman's existing foundry operations a block away.

Pier Foundry & Pattern Shop (St. Paul, Minnesota) has invested in an FBO-IIIS Mold Machine from Sinto, complete with a mold handling system and Sinto Analytics.

Annualized SinterCast CGI series production for the first two months of the year reached 3.1 million Engine Equivalents, providing a 5.4% year-on-year increase. The sampling volume at customer foundries remained stable at recent run-rates throughout February, providing a positive indication for foundry shipments into March, SinterCast AB reports.
